NanoOpto Corp., MOXTEK, Inc. Announce Joint Product Development

Abstract:
NanoOpto Corporation, which is applying novel design methods and proprietary nano-fabrication technology to produce a broad range of unique optical components that enable higher quality, low-cost optical components and systems, and MOXTEK, Inc., which pioneered and now manufactures exclusively, using its own proprietary nano-fabrication technology, wire-grid polarizers for leading rear-projection TV manufacturers and other OEM manufacturers working in the range of the Ultra-Violet through the Infra-red to a world-wide market, recently announced they will jointly develop a suite of nanotechnology-based optical products for various consumer electronics markets.
